Lemon Beef and Pasta

"Marinating
the meat in the lemon juice adds a nice flavor and also
starts a tenderizing process. Leftover ground beef,
or cooked chicken would also work well in this this
recipe. Cooking is a Creative Sport."
Ingredients
1
cup cooked roast beef
1 cup dried pasta ( I like the flat noodles for this
recipe)
1/2 cup onion, diced
1/4 cup lemon juice
1/4 cup catsup
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 tablespoon butter
1 tablespoon olive oil
Method
- Place
the beef in a shallow dish and mix with the lemon
juice.
- Cook
the pasta according to directions and drain.
- Melt
the butter with the oil in a frying pan, and sauté
the onions until transparent.
- Add
the catsup, followed by the brown sugar and salt.
- Add
the meat, cook until hot, then add the cooked noodles
and stir until coated.
Serves
1
